SEMA Preview 4 of 10: Half Mobile Mk4 Update

This year for SEMA, we built an all-new Factory Five half mobile for our best-selling Mk4 Roadster. The car is a running, driving Mk4 with a monster 535 HP 351W/427 engine running on race gas. The car was designed to be a period-correct 427 replica complete with 15″ Halibrand wheels, Goodyear billboard tires, and vintage gauges/interior. The paint is vintage gloss black with Wimbledon White stripes and vintage decals replicating the first 427-powered Cobra driven by Ken Miles at Riverside, CSX 3002.

After SEMA, this car will be in our showroom and part of our road tours at shows and events.

Our two best-selling cars each have a running, driving half mobile demo so that customers can see the chassis internals, wiring, and suspension/plumbing.
The Mk4 Half Mobile is favorite at shows and events.
